U-space SESAR projects present preliminary results on drone integration
On 28 and 30 April, SESAR JU organised a series of webinars bringing together representatives from the recently closed U-space projects to present their preliminary results. Over 1,400 joined the webinars altogether, which were organised within the framework of the SESAR Digital Academy. The sessions provided an overview of the concept of operations developed for U-space, as well as research and demonstration work addressing critical communications, surveillance and tracking, information management and exchange, detect and avoid, and CNS technologies.

Still time to apply for the SESAR JU demonstration call
The SESAR Joint Undertaking has launched an open call for very-large scale demonstration projects within the framework of the SESAR 2020 research and innovation programme. The call covers a wide range of topics aimed at boosting the performance of aviation in Europe, with a focus on sustainability, capacity and urban air mobility. A total of EUR 19.5 million is earmarked for this research from the EU’s Horizon 2020 budget.
New submission deadline: 16 June 2020.
